Background technology
Adsorbent is also referred to as absorbent, and this substance can make active constituent be attached to its particle surface, makes the micro chemical combination of liquid
Object additive becomes solid compounds, is conducive to implement uniformly to mix, and being one kind can effectively adsorb from gas or liquid
The solid matter of some of which ingredient.With big specific surface, suitable pore structure and surface texture;Have to adsorbate strong
Adsorption capacity;It is not chemically reacted with adsorbate and medium generally;Easily manufactured, regenerating easily;Have fabulous adsorptivity and
Mechanicalness characteristic.
For the materials such as polystyrene, polyurethane under the dissolved state of organic solvent, the viscosity of change is very big, and organic solvent is such as
Acetone, chloroform etc. volatilize comparatively fast at normal temperatures, are easy to solidify hardened, conventional production method with adsorbent material after mixing and hold
Stifled machine is easily caused, causes production discontinuous, cleaning is difficult, or even causes equipment damage.

Embodiment one:
The adsorbent material for being 300 μm by 1000kg fineness, polystyrene, polyurethane with 200kg fineness for 1000 μm
Equal materials, are thrown into first material storehouse 2 by air delivery tube line by the flow of 30kg/min, are then mixed by mixing vessel 5
60min, the material mixed enter via second material storehouse 8 in double worm mixer 9, and spray equipment a is by chloroform by 30%
Quality is directly added by common pipe in mixed material than charge door, before being driven by the helical blade f of the unsegmented of same shape
Into enter single screw extrusion machine 10 in, by single screw extrusion machine 10 (screw pitch is identical, plus stirring screw h) mix again after, from
Head orifice plate i is squeezed out, and the strip-shaped materials of extrusion are fed again into the material distributing machine 11 with sliding rail and the dry zone with recycling function
In machine, dry strip adsorbent material is obtained, bar obtains 2mm granule adsorbents after crusher in crushing, and experiment is surveyed
, the material physical strength of synthesis is 82%, and drying time is long, and adsorption capacity is low, and forming is bad.
Embodiment two:
The adsorbent material for being 200 μm by 1000kg fineness, polystyrene, the polyurethane etc. for being 500 μm with 100kg fineness
Material is thrown into first material storehouse 2 by air delivery tube line by the flow of 30kg/min, is then mixed by mixing vessel 5
60min, the material mixed enter via second material storehouse 8 in double worm mixer 9, by chloroform by 30% mass ratio from adding
Material mouth is directly added by single common pipe in mixed material, by the helical blade f drive of the unsegmented of same shape advance into
Enter in single screw extrusion machine 10, by single screw extrusion machine 10, (screw pitch is identical, after not adding stirring screw h) to mix again, from orifice plate
It squeezes out, the strip-shaped materials of extrusion are switched to 0.5cm sizes by head scraper j, and granular adsorbent material is fed again into cunning
The material distributing machine 11 of rail and with recycling function dry zone machine in, obtain dry granular adsorbent material, experiment measures, close
At material physical strength be 93%, drying time is long, and adsorption capacity is medium, forming it is bad.
Embodiment three:
The adsorbent material for being 100 μm by 1000kg fineness, polystyrene, the polyurethane etc. for being 200 μm with 100kg fineness
Material is thrown into first material storehouse 2 by air delivery tube line by the flow of 30kg/min, is then mixed by mixing vessel 5
60min, the material mixed enter in double worm mixer 9 via second material storehouse 8, are pressed chloroform by spray equipment a
26.5% mass ratio is uniformly added in mixed material, by helical blade f of different shapes (band vertically with the mixing leaf of axis
Piece) it drives and advances into single screw extrusion machine 10, by single screw extrusion machine 10, (screw pitch tapers into, and installs stirring screw h) additional
It after mixing again, is squeezed out from orifice plate, the strip-shaped materials of extrusion are switched to 0.5cm sizes by head scraper j, cut rear particle than example one
It is all closely knit with example two, and viscosity is small, granular adsorbent material is fed again into the material distributing machine 11 with sliding rail and has
In the dry zone machine for recycling function, dry granular adsorbent material is obtained, experiment measures, and the material physical strength of synthesis is
96.5%, drying time is short, and adsorption capacity is high, and shaped particles are good.
In use, by the adsorbent powdery material A after crushing, via airflow pipeline 1, it is delivered to being precisely weighed
At the same time it slowly opens the first charge door 3 and the adhesive material B after crushing is added to gas in the first material storehouse 2 of system
It flows in conveyance conduit 1, enters first material storehouse 2 together, material A presses certain mass ratio with B, and being weighed by intelligence is
System, it will while addition finishes, and in first material storehouse 2, two kinds of materials have obtained first mixing, open rotary feeding valve 4, by the
Material in one material bin 2 is added in mixing vessel 5, opens and carries double-stranded homogenizer so that two kinds of materials
It is mixed by fast deep, opens rotary valve 6 and put into second material storehouse 8, then by spiral shell by material via pipe chain conveying device 7
Rotation feeder puts into material in double worm mixer 9, by bottom weight-loss metering and intelligent Loading Control System, by liquid
Material C is sent to by metering pump in double worm mixer 9, abundant kneading of three kinds of materials through double helix blade f, is sent into single screw rod
Extruder 10, extruded material by head scraper j, neatly be sent into the material distributing machine 11 swung by front end, then to 10mm by putting by slitting
Dynamic material distributing machine 11 is sent into net-bag type drying box 12, and the organic gas of volatilization is recycled to front end by retracting device and recycles.
